Honestly, for PC laptops I tend to buy a 2 to 3-year-old off-lease business
model for cheap and then just swap them every year to two. I max their RAM and
swap SATA HDDs for SSDs and have been pretty pleased. I would look for a
Latitude 6410 or 6420 with the Quadro card, or 6510/6520 if you
I'm deploying several Lenovo T530's - solid machines with excellent
performance.
But if 90% of what you're doing is online, have you considered a
Chromebook? They're great for this type of work and very attractively
priced.
